What distinguishes a high efficiency fireplace from a traditional fireplace?

A high efficiency fireplace is characterized by features that maximize combustion efficiency, which plays a crucial role in reducing heat loss and improving overall performance. The correct choice highlights the role of an insulated cabinet. This insulation helps retain heat within the fireplace, allowing for better combustion of fuel and reducing the amount of heat that escapes into the environment. This results in a more effective and cleaner burn, contributing to higher efficiency.

In contrast, traditional fireplaces often lack such insulation, leading to significant heat loss as warmth is expelled up the chimney. The design of high efficiency fireplaces is engineered to improve heat retention and enhance combustion quality.

The other options do not accurately reflect the key distinction between high efficiency and traditional fireplaces. Open combustion techniques typically allow more air flow and can be less efficient due to greater heat loss. A larger chimney diameter is not a requirement of high efficiency fireplaces and can lead to inefficiencies instead. Lastly, decorative elements do not contribute to the efficiency of a fireplace; they serve aesthetic purposes rather than functional improvements in heat output or fuel consumption.
